"Not sure if this answers the original issue but I had a broken image icon when looking back at old conversations. The following did the trick:
Exit out of Teams Desktop app. Clear this folder %AppData%\Microsoft\Teams\Cache. Relaunch Teams and the images now show."
This solved it for me but it will happen again,
